4-fold binary output

DIN-Rail mount modules

CODE: EK-FA1-TP

Description

The Ekinex® EK-FA1-TP binary output allows to command 4 groups of loads independently; to this purpose, the device has outputs fitted with potential-free relays, . The device’s latching relays guarantee the upkeep of command status even in the case of bus power failures. The front levers indicate the status of each output channel and, in case of emergency, allow manual command (by means of a tool) of the loads. The device integrates a KNX bus communication module and is realized for mounting on a standard 35 mm DIN-rail. The device is supplied by the KNX bus and does not require auxiliary power supply.

Technical data
Power supply 
  • 30 Vdc voltage by KNX bus
  • Current consumption from bus < 12 mA
  • Power from bus 360 mW
Outputs
  • 4 latch relays
  • Nominal voltage (Un): 100-230Vac, 50/60Hz
  • Nominal current (In): max 10 A (both @100Vac and @230Vac)
  • Switched power: 1000W @100Vac - 2200 W @230Vac
Delivery
Delivery includes a terminal block for connection to the bus.
Functions / Features
  • Plastic casing
  • Frontal programming pushbutton and LED
  • Connection to bus line with KNX terminal block
  • Connection of outputs with screw terminals
  • Overvoltage class III (according to EN 60664-1)
  • Classification climatic 3K5 and mechanical 3M2 (according to EN 50491-2)
  • Pollution degree 2 (according to IEC 60664-1)
  • Installation on 35 mm rail (according to EN 60715)
  • 4 modular units (1 MU = 18 mm)
  • IP20 protection degree (installed device)
  • Weight 205 g
